Times when you might have to sport black-tie attire:

• at weddings
• when attending a fancy dress party
• while ballroom dancing
• in the course of imitating James Bond
• when striving to impress someone by ironically overdressing

Whatever the circumstances, this tuxedo-inspired, hand-knit bow tie will secure you a spot on the guest list and in the hearts of all who behold it.
